IMMUNE STATUS IN PIGLETS IN CONNECTION WITH TIME AND DOSE OF INJECTION OF SODIUM NUCLEINATE DURING VACCINATION
A.V. Krivopushkin1, E.V. Krapivina1, Yu.N. Fedorov2
In industrial conditions the authors estimated the immune status in piglets of the White Large breed during vaccination against leptospirosis with application of nature immunomodulating activity of sodium nucleinate. It was shown, that a forming of immune response depends on the dose of medication and the time of its injection. The injection of sodium nucleinate before vaccination against leptospirosis or at the same time stimulates more pronounced immune response.
